Patience and Persistence
Jesus told this parable: ‘A man had a fig tree planted in his vineyard, and he came looking for fruit on it but found none. He said to the man who looked after the vineyard, “Look here, for three years now I have been coming to look for fruit on this fig tree and finding none. Cut it down: why should it be taking up the ground?” “Sir,” the man replied “leave it one more year and give me time to dig round it and manure it: it may bear fruit next year; if not, then you can cut it down.”
*********
In culinary esoteric philosophy, this parable can be interpreted on multiple levels, reflecting both the nature of nourishment and the cultivation of potential, whether in the literal sense of gardening or in the metaphorical sense of human development and persistence.
1. **Patience and Nurturing**: The fig tree represents potential that has not yet borne fruit despite care and time. The caretaker’s request for one more year symbolizes the importance of patience and nurturing in the growth process.
In culinary art, just as ingredients require specific conditions to flourish, so do ideas and projects need time and proper care to develop fully.
2. **Balance of Resource Allocation**: The vineyard owner's desire to cut down the unfruitful tree highlights the practical decision-making involved in resource management.
In culinary terms, this can be likened to evaluating the viability of ingredients, techniques, or even culinary ventures that might not show immediate results.
3. **Potential for Transformation**: The caretaker's suggestion to dig around the tree and manure it signifies the idea of providing support and nourishment to realize potential.
In cooking, this can be interpreted as the need for experimentation, adjustment, and care in techniques, flavors, or concepts that may initially seem uninspired but can transform into something wonderful with the right attention.
4. **Hope and Second Chances**: The parable also encapsulates the theme of hope and the importance of giving second chances, relevant both in culinary practice and in life.
Just as the fig tree may still bear fruit, creative endeavors in the kitchen might yield unexpected results with perseverance.
In essence, this parable reminds us within the sphere of culinary arts (and beyond) to appreciate the process of growth, the importance of nurturing potential, and the value of patience in seeking fruitful outcomes.

Acorn Woodpecker (Melanerpes formicivorus) drill thousands of small holes into the bark of living or dead trees, telephone poles, wooden fence posts, and even wooden parts of buildings. And yes they can get into scuffles with squirrels to protect their cache of acorns.

Sometimes I think a lot about my mom's cat
My mom's cat is a common domestic shorthair we found on the side of the road as a kitten
Regular cat, not a maine coon or one of those massive breeds. His mom was smaller than a loaf of bread
But in a sort of a Clifford The Big Red Dog situation, he grew super fast, and really really big, and took a super long time to stop growing
Worried that she was overfeeding him, she eased back his portions, but he stayed a massive round baby
When he started having kidney problems, she took him to the vet.
The vet took a look at him and said, "holy fuck, what are you feeding him", checked the nutritional listings on his chow, and told her "Yeah, maybe he's reacting badly to the amount of grain in this, try a meatier diet"
So my mom wound up special-ordering this specific high-protein prescription cat food made of like. Kangaroo meat or some shit that cost like sixty bucks a bag
And, as typical act two in an episode of House, he somehow got worse on the fancy specialized stuff that was supposed to be Primo Athlete Olympic Feline Blend
Like. WAY worse. His guts were inflamed and his kidneys were shutting down and he was all sore and HE WAS STILL HUGE, just miserable and sad
So shetook him back to the vet, where they had to help him pee (he was apparently close to bursting and had some kind of blockage too) and went "Yeah no this is NOT normal and we don't know what's going on, we're gonna do some tests but in the meantime you should go back to what he was eating before, at least that wasn't actively killing him" so she did
And he still wasn't great, but he also improved
And so they take his blood and do an ultrasound and a couple g's later she gets a call back like "this is gonna sound crazy, but we want you to put him on a low-meat diet. Just the least amount of protein and iron and shit. We need you to find the grainiest, filler-iest dollar tree kibble available and give him some of that bad bad shit"
And my mother is a woman of science. So she did
And he GOT BETTER
His energy picked back up, inflammation went down, he started drinking normally again, got back to pissing like a fuckin champion
And so it turns out that out of all the random ass freeway bonus cats we possibly could have scooped out of a ditch, WE got the one-in-a-million freak of nature with a SPECIFIC genetic defect that means a paleo protein free range diet is essentially poison and he THRIVES on cheap ass garbage
Like. He medically NEEDS junk food
I dont really understand how that works, but i cant argue with results.
If we had four of him, they'd outweigh my mom. And he's FINE
Also blind, but that's unrelated
Im not using him as a symbol or a metaphor or anything. I just keep catching myself thinking about my mom's Big Fucking Cat
